The iLiad is probably your best bet at present. It doesn't have a "Librarian" facility at all, as the other eBook readers do - one simply opens files directly from the directory "tree" just as you'd do on a PC. You could use a directory structure just as you do on the Palm.

Bookeen have promised a "folder view" for the next ROM release of the Gen3, but obviously how good it will be - or when it will be available - is a complete unknown at present.
